Are you dreaming of a wedding that perfectly blends elegance, simplicity, and the timeless charm of Nordic aesthetics? Look no further as we embark on a journey through interior design to unveil the most captivating ideas that will inspire your Nordic wedding.


A wedding is a magical celebration of love, and for those who appreciate the beauty of Nordic aesthetics, creating a wedding inspired by Scandinavian interior design can transport guests to a world of elegance, simplicity, and natural charm.
In this article, we will explore a myriad of inspiring interior design ideas to help you plan and execute a Nordic-inspired wedding that is truly unforgettable.


Minimalistic Elegance


Nordic design is renowned for its minimalistic approach, emphasizing clean lines, neutral color palettes, and uncluttered spaces. Incorporating these elements into your wedding decor will create an ambiance of timeless elegance.
Opt for simple yet sophisticated table settings featuring crisp white linens, modern dinnerware, and minimalist glassware. Accentuate the tables with natural elements like pinecones, sprigs of evergreen, or delicate wildflowers to add a touch of organic beauty.


Cozy Textures


Nordic design embraces cozy textures that evoke a sense of warmth and comfort. To infuse this element into your wedding, consider using plush faux fur throws on chairs or benches, creating inviting seating areas where guests can relax and enjoy the festivities.


Enhance the romantic atmosphere with soft candlelight, using wood, brass, or glass candle holders to complement the overall Nordic aesthetic. Incorporate knitted accents, such as chunky blankets or cushion covers, for an extra dose of tactile charm.


Natural Elements


One of the hallmarks of Nordic design is the integration of nature-inspired elements. For your wedding, incorporate organic materials like wood, stone, and leather to create an earthy, rustic feel. Adorn the wedding venue with branches of birch or eucalyptus, adding a touch of greenery to the space.
Use wooden slabs as table centerpieces, showcasing beautifully arranged floral displays or delicate tea light candles. Bring the outdoors inside with potted plants and moss accents, creating a serene and authentic Nordic atmosphere.


Soft Color Palette


Nordic design often features a soft, soothing color palette reminiscent of the region’s natural landscapes. Incorporate hues of white, cream, gray, and pale pastels into your wedding decor to create a serene and harmonious ambiance.
These subtle tones complement the minimalist aesthetic and allow other design elements to shine. Consider incorporating small pops of color with delicate flowers or tableware to add visual interest and depth to the overall design.


Scandinavian-inspired Tablescapes


A Nordic wedding wouldn’t be complete without exquisite tablescapes embodying Scandinavian design’s essence. Opt for wooden or marble table surfaces paired with sleek, modern chairs.


Layer the table with crisp white linens and minimalist tableware, such as matte ceramic plates and brushed metallic cutlery. Add a touch of elegance with crystal glassware or delicate stemless wine glasses. Complete the look with minimalist floral arrangements featuring delicate blooms and greenery nestled in sleek, modern vases.


Lighting and Atmosphere


Lighting is crucial in creating the perfect ambiance for a Nordic wedding. Incorporate soft, warm lighting through fairy lights draped over the ceiling or wrapped around pillars.
Opt for delicate pendant lights or Scandinavian-inspired chandeliers that emit a soft, diffused glow. Enhance the cozy atmosphere by strategically placing floor or table lamps, creating pockets of warm light throughout the venue. Experiment with different light intensities to achieve a romantic and intimate ambiance.


Nordic-Inspired Ceremony Space


Set the tone for your Nordic wedding by creating a captivating ceremony space. Choose a venue with natural surroundings, such as a picturesque forest, a serene lakeside, or a cozy winter lodge.
Incorporate wooden arches adorned with ethereal drapes or garlands of fresh flowers and greenery. Complete the look with cozy seating options, such as rustic wooden benches or fur-covered chairs, providing your guests with a comfortable and inviting atmosphere.


Hygge-Inspired Lounge Areas


Embrace the Danish concept of “hygge” by creating cozy lounge areas for your guests to relax and enjoy the celebration. Arrange plush sofas, armchairs, and oversized floor cushions in warm and earthy tones, adorned with soft blankets and cushions.
Include a rustic wooden coffee table with candles and trays of Scandinavian treats like cinnamon buns or gingerbread cookies. This cozy space will provide a retreat for guests to unwind and connect in a relaxed and intimate setting.

The path to a happy marriage is never easy, and the wedding tradition seems to emphasize this – in different countries, a couple in love wait for their strange customs. In Austria, for example, the bride wakes up to the sound of gunfire, and in China, she cries a month before the ceremony. In the midst of the wedding season, we gathered the most interesting beliefs so that you would be prepared for anything, both as a guest and as a bride.

China

The wedding for the Tujia people of China’s ethnic group begins with tears: one month before the ceremony, the bride is expected to cry, showing thanks to her parents and her reluctance to leave the house. Later, she is joined by sisters, aunts, grandmothers and mother. On a full series of «cry of the bride» performed in the XVII century, now it is more an occasion to gather the whole family – without any tears.

Japan

In the Country of the Rising Sun over 400 years have been observed one of the oldest wedding traditions – «San-san kudo». Instead of exchanging vows, the groom, the bride and their parents drink three sake cups of three different sizes: the first for the union of families, and the second and third for the atmosphere of love in a house free of hatred and ignorance.

Tunis

The celebration of the wedding in Tunis begins six days before the ceremony itself. A special role in the preparation is played by the custom of decorating the bride’s hands and legs with henna – drawings in the form of butterflies and flowers and intricate patterns usually applied by a relative.

India

The night before the wedding, married girlfriends gather at the bride’s house to put a turmeric paste on her. It is believed that its bright yellow colour will bring good luck to the future family, and the composition of the useful mixture will make the skin of the woman smooth and radiant. And if you can’t believe the first statement, then you can’t argue with the second one: the turmeric actually calms the inflammation, increases the elasticity of the skin and equalizes the tone.

Sweden

It is customary here to place a coin in the shoe of the bride: in one, given by the father – made of gold, in the other – silver, given by the mother. And every time the bride leaves the table, all the girls at the wedding can steal the groom’s kiss. Note that these are Swedes who adhere to the principle of equality and gender neutrality. So whenever the groom leaves the room, gentlemen can also kiss the bride.

Austria

Austrian custom dictates that the bride wakes up on the day of the ceremony as early as possible. Many families in Salzkammergut, Tyrol and Styria still follow an ancient tradition and, as their ancestors did, come to the girl’s house early in the morning to wake her with the sounds of gunfire and fireworks – they believe that this noise will ward off evil spirits.

Brazil

Brazilian brides primarily take care of single girlfriends: their names are written on the lining of a wedding dress, believing that it will help girls find love as soon as possible. Interestingly, the Greeks have a similar tradition, but they have a list of singles decorating the soles of the bride’s shoes.

Venezuela

The groom must give permission for the marriage to the godfather, otherwise the spouses will not be happy. At a wedding party, newlyweds can sneak out before the event is over. And it’s considered good luck for a guest to catch a couple when they try to escape.
